ChEBI Name
(13
R
)-13-dihydrocarminomycin
ChEBI ID
CHEBI:31058
ChEBI ASCII Name
(13R)-13-dihydrocarminomycin
Definition
A anthracycline antibiotic that is a cardiotoxic metabolite of carminomycin obtained by formal reduction of the carbonyl group.
